Assistant General Counsel
Serve as primary legal partner for Upstart's HELOC product, providing strategic counsel on consumer lending laws, mortgage regulations, product development, and regulatory risk to support launch, scaling, and transition to national bank partnership. Requires JD, 10+ years experience in real estate secured lending, and deep expertise in TILA/RESPA/ECOA and related laws.
